Bookroo's summary

On a sun-drenched beach, a spirited girl and her dragon friend embark on a thrilling quest for hidden treasure, racing against a band of pirates. Amidst building sandcastles and splashing in the waves, she imparts crucial water safety lessons to her adventurous companion. Will they outsmart the pirates and find the treasure? From the publisher

Fun and safety go hand in hand as a little girl and a dragon spend a hot summer day at the beach. The two friends build castles in the sand, splash and swim, and race a boatload of pirates to a hidden treasure. As they play, the girl teaches her irrepressible friend to be water smart. The winning combination of adventure and safety information — including The Dragon’s Water Safety Rhyme and the checklist of rules at the end of the book — provide the perfect starting point for safety discussions.
